Never heard of such a thing.

6Gb drives use an older design than modern large drives. I'd consider a modern large drive far more reliable.

Stick to a name brand, of course. For instance Samsung and Fujitsu drives in my experience have very short lifetimes - they also have commensurably short warranty periods.

All laptop drives are slow - they're generally 4500 RPM. That's the tradeoff for making them so small.
